The Importance and Necessity of Water Spraying Tests for BESS Containers

9/23/2024

 
Battery Energy Storage Systems (BESS) are increasingly popular for providing efficient and sustainable energy storage solutions, especially in industrial and commercial applications. However, given that BESS containers are often placed outdoors or in harsh environments, ensuring their durability and safety is paramount. One essential method for verifying their resilience against water ingress is the water spraying test. This article explores the importance and necessity of water spraying tests for BESS containers, ensuring long-term safety, performance, and reliability.

What is a Water Spraying Test?

A water spraying test is a procedure designed to simulate various weather conditions, such as heavy rain or water exposure, to evaluate the water resistance and sealing quality of BESS containers. By subjecting the container to high-pressure water jets from multiple angles, the test ensures that there are no leaks, weak points, or vulnerabilities in the container’s design and construction.

Why Are Water Spraying Tests Essential for BESS Containers?

1. Ensuring Safety and Protection

BESS containers house valuable and sensitive electrical components, batteries, and control systems. Any water penetration can lead to short circuits, electrical faults, or even catastrophic failures, such as fires or explosions. A water spraying test ensures that the container’s design is watertight, effectively protecting the internal components from water damage, thereby preventing hazardous situations.

2. Maintaining Optimal Performance

Moisture and water ingress can drastically reduce the efficiency and lifespan of battery cells and other electronic components within the BESS container. Corrosion, rust, or electrical malfunctions caused by water exposure can significantly impact the performance of the energy storage system. The water spraying test ensures that the container remains sealed, allowing the BESS to function optimally and maintain its performance over time.

3. Enhancing Durability and Longevity

BESS containers are often deployed in diverse environments, ranging from coastal areas to industrial sites, where they are exposed to extreme weather conditions, including rain, snow, or humidity. Conducting a water spraying test ensures that the container can withstand these elements, enhancing its durability and extending its operational lifespan. This added resilience means fewer maintenance issues and a reduced likelihood of unexpected downtime.

4. Compliance with Industry Standards

Water spraying tests help ensure that BESS containers meet international safety and quality standards, such as IP (Ingress Protection) ratings. Meeting these standards demonstrates that the container has been rigorously tested and verified to provide adequate protection against water ingress. This compliance is often a requirement for insurance coverage, certifications, and regulatory approvals, making it an essential aspect of the BESS container manufacturing process.

The Water Spraying Test Process for BESS Containers

The water spraying test involves subjecting the container to water jets from various angles, simulating real-world exposure to rain or water. Typically, this process includes:

•    Preparation: Ensuring the container is fully sealed and all entry points (doors, vents, cable entry points) are closed.
•    Testing: Water jets are sprayed at specific pressures and angles for a set duration to mimic heavy rain or water exposure.
•    Inspection: After the test, the container is inspected for any signs of water ingress or leakage.

Passing the water spraying test means the BESS container can effectively protect its internal components from water-related damage, ensuring safety, performance, and durability.

Conclusion

The water spraying test is a critical quality assurance step in the manufacturing and deployment of BESS containers. It ensures that the container is watertight, protecting valuable electrical components, maintaining performance, enhancing durability, and meeting industry standards. By investing in this testing process, manufacturers and users of BESS containers can ensure the safety, reliability, and longevity of their energy storage systems, making it an essential aspect of BESS container deployment in any environment.
